The candidate passed the 10+2 examination with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ics as mandatory subjects with 50% marks in aggregate and also at least 50% marks in aggregate of the 10+2 examination. OR Passed the 10+3 Diploma examination with Mathematics as a compulsory subject having obtained at least 50% marks (45% marks in case of candidates belonging to reserved category) in the aggregate and Qualifying NATA (Or) Any other Aptitude Test conducted by Competent Authority of the State Government/ UT.
The candidate should have passed 10+2 with maths with min. 50% aggregate marks (as per COA norms) from a recognized Institute.
